DON'T buy into #MikeJohnson's pathetic excuse for not swearing in duly-elected #AdelitaGrijalva.

Elected official CAN be sworn in during a government shutdown.

Want some precedent?

The full House was sworn in during a government shutdown when a new Congress started in January 2019.
#EpsteinFiles
Swearing-in ceremonies are not halted by a shutdown, because they are constitutional or statutory duties, not discretionary spending activities.

A government shutdown affects agencies and programs that rely on annual appropriations, but Congress itself and the offices of elected officials (federal, state, or local) usually remain operational for essential and constitutional functions.

For example:

Members of Congress can still take the oath of office even if parts of the federal government are closed. Congressional operations are funded separately under permanent appropriations.

Presidents are sworn in on January 20th regardless of any shutdown. The inauguration is a constitutional event that cannot be postponed by funding gaps.

State and local officials are likewise sworn in per their state constitutions or laws — those events are governed by state authority, not federal funding.
